Analyze, test, troubleshoot, and evaluate existing network systems, such as local area network (LAN), wide area network (WAN), and Internet systems or a segment of a network system. Perform network maintenance to ensure networks operate correctly with minimal interruption.
<ul><li>Back up network data.</li><li>Configure security settings or access permissions for groups or individuals.</li><li>Analyze and report computer network security breaches or attempted breaches.</li><li>Identify the causes of networking problems, using diagnostic testing software and equipment.</li><li>Document network support activities.</li><li>Configure wide area network (WAN) or local area network (LAN) routers or related equipment.</li><li>Install network software, including security or firewall software.</li><li>Analyze network data to determine network usage, disk space availability, or server function.</li><li>Evaluate local area network (LAN) or wide area network (WAN) performance data to ensure sufficient availability or speed, to identify network problems, or for disaster recovery purposes.</li><li>Troubleshoot network or connectivity problems for users or user groups.</li><li>Provide telephone support related to networking or connectivity issues.</li><li>Perform routine maintenance or standard repairs to networking components or equipment.</li><li>Configure and define parameters for installation or testing of local area network (LAN), wide area network (WAN), hubs, routers, switches, controllers, multiplexers, or related networking equipment.</li><li>Install new hardware or software systems or components, ensuring integration with existing network systems.</li><li>Install or repair network cables, including fiber optic cables.</li><li>Test computer software or hardware, using standard diagnostic testing equipment and procedures.</li><li>Monitor industry websites or publications for information about patches, releases, viruses, or potential problem identification.</li><li>Create or update technical documentation for network installations or changes to existing installations.</li><li>Train users in procedures related to network applications software or related systems.</li><li>Test repaired items to ensure proper operation.</li><li>Install and configure wireless networking equipment.</li><li>Document help desk requests and resolutions.</li><li>Maintain logs of network activity.</li><li>Research hardware or software products to meet technical networking or security needs.</li><li>Create or revise user instructions, procedures, or manuals.</li><li>Run monthly network reports.</li></ul>
